Output 3cc235c70e9577a608adb5349907c6fd3090533f760c6ed15a7919105e2e086e:1

value
673692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f93f5afdd3f2fb9acab156e0221aaeef24be26 OP_EQUAL
address
3JjeCF3J8cSjv4qx7yXBXhafvYZVhtefSZ
transaction
3cc235c70e9577a608adb5349907c6fd3090533f760c6ed15a7919105e2e086e